Initial Setup
1. Connect the FS-4 HD through its COMPUTER I/O 1394 port to the
computer system using a standard 6-pin to 6-pin FireWire cable.
2. Enter HDD mode and enable DD Drive.
This step is required before mounting the FS-4 HD to a computer.
On the FS-4 HD go to the
HDD screen.
•Select
DD Drive and Right arrow to Connect screen.
•Press
Enable function button.
Refer to the section,
HDD Mode Screen on page 57
3. Connect power to the drive if necessary.
4. Consult the computer’s documentation for more information.
Mounting the FS-4 HD in Windows
Use this procedure for Windows XP, 2000, 98SE and ME.
1. On a Windows-based computer system, double click the My
Computer
icon on the top left hand corner of the desktop. A
directory window appears.
2. Locate the FS-4 HD drive and open it.
Often, it appears as a standard FireWire disk drive and may be
labeled E:, F:, G:, and so on.
3. Open the FS-4 HD disk icon.
